Minutes — Management Meeting, Varnholt Fabrication Group

Attendees: department heads, chaired by M. Drelling.

The committee reviewed utilisation figures for the Kestrel Line at the Aldbury plant. Output has held at 92% of rated capacity for three consecutive quarters. After careful discussion of tooling lead times and staffing constraints, the heads agreed to defer a final decision on the second extrusion hall pending cost validation. The strategic rationale is recorded below for restricted circulation.

board note of fahif-yahog: Gross margin on Wenath came in at 10 percent against a plan of 5 percent. Only 3 of the 100 pilot accounts renewed Wenath, so a churn review is set for July 15.

### Account Recovery — Catalogue Import (Lintwood)

Quick one for review: when the Lintwood catalogue import wipes a patron's session table, the recovery flow re-seeds accounts from the nightly snapshot. Check that the importer skips locked accounts — last time it didn't. To rerun recovery against staging you'll need the vault passphrase, which is appended just below.

recovery phrase for yafof-tajof: julmir-kelax-julvan-holath-belvan-holir-ralael-ralvan-ralath-julvan-silmir-istmir-kaswyn-ulamir

**Ticket: Config drift on BounceSift processor**

The email bounce processor in the Larkfield environment has drifted from the values committed in the release branch. Retry windows and suppression thresholds no longer match, which likely explains the duplicate suppression entries reported Tuesday. Please reconcile before the Thursday cut. For reference, the currently deployed configuration on the live node reads as follows.

config for yajep-yahof:
[briax]
port = 9200
region = outer-2
host = briax.nelvrocorp.test
team = raleth
timeout_ms = 1500
retries = 1